A number of photographs of Bob Marley's never-before seen appear on the 30th anniversary of the artist's death.
Known as the greatest name in Reggae music, Marley's first-published photographs were described as "a treasure."
In the 1970s, photographer Kim Gottlieb-Walker, who was in the immediate vicinity of the Jamaican singer, printed photographs of Bob Marley in daily life for the first time in a book.
